Effective Research Requires a StrategyInformation is Everywhere: Or, Verbing Our Way Through Life“I just googled it and found what you were looking for.”“Wiki it first, then come ask me if you have questions.”“YouTube that clip for me, okay?”Making Sense of It AllStrategy is EssentialA thoughtful strategy is an essential component of a successful search for informationWhy? Because without a strategy, we are left floundering in the sea of information.Finding Information: The Status QuoThe usual scenario begins with a research topicExamples?Your first mode of attack?GOOGLE!GooglingProsVarious databases (images, video, etc.)Lots of possibilitiesMuch of the work is (seemingly) done for you!ConsThe “wild goose chase” problemDifficult to sort through results quicklyDifficult to discern the reliability of the sourceWikipediaProsFamiliar, encyclopedia-like formatLinks to other sources of information availableConsVery few (if any) criteria for contributing entriesInformation often seems complete, thus most users are unlikely to feel further searching is necessaryWell, Maybe…YouTubeProsVariety of information availableProvides access to information that might be considered less mainstream, because of its accessibilityConsNO criteria for uploading video, so credibility needs to be consideredBecause of its “multinationality,” boundaries (social, cultural, racial, etc.) are often neglected or ignoredEffective Research = Making ChoicesThe first big thing to realize when usingthese various web tools is: all information is NOT created equal!
